Merge !675: daemon: first part of refactoring
- mainly the daemon/session.* files are separated, moving lots of logic from daemon/worker.*; - lib/generic/queue.* are added; - verbose logging gets different IDs; - various minor changes around.
No related branches found
No related tags found
Pipeline #41308 passed with warnings
Stage: build
Stage: test
Stage: coverage
Stage: respdiff
Stage: deploy
Showing
- daemon/daemon.mk 1 addition, 0 deletionsdaemon/daemon.mk
- daemon/engine.c 16 additions, 0 deletionsdaemon/engine.c
- daemon/engine.h 0 additions, 27 deletionsdaemon/engine.h
- daemon/io.c 136 additions, 178 deletionsdaemon/io.c
- daemon/io.h 1 addition, 27 deletionsdaemon/io.h
- daemon/lua/kres-gen.lua 1 addition, 0 deletionsdaemon/lua/kres-gen.lua
- daemon/main.c 13 additions, 14 deletionsdaemon/main.c
- daemon/session.c 755 additions, 0 deletionsdaemon/session.c
- daemon/session.h 146 additions, 0 deletionsdaemon/session.h
- daemon/tls.c 73 additions, 57 deletionsdaemon/tls.c
- daemon/tls.h 3 additions, 2 deletionsdaemon/tls.h
- daemon/worker.c 500 additions, 1206 deletionsdaemon/worker.c
- daemon/worker.h 42 additions, 57 deletionsdaemon/worker.h
- lib/cache/api.c 2 additions, 1 deletionlib/cache/api.c
- lib/defines.h 4 additions, 0 deletionslib/defines.h
- lib/generic/README.rst 7 additions, 0 deletionslib/generic/README.rst
- lib/generic/lru.c 9 additions, 1 deletionlib/generic/lru.c
- lib/generic/lru.h 6 additions, 7 deletionslib/generic/lru.h
- lib/generic/queue.c 124 additions, 0 deletionslib/generic/queue.c
- lib/generic/queue.h 257 additions, 0 deletionslib/generic/queue.h
Loading
Please register or sign in to comment